According to the Code of Medical Ethics the consent is part of the informative process (see right to information about his or her health) regulated by article 30 of the Code and does not replace it. The physician should provide to the patient the most suitable information about the diagnosis, the prognosis, and the eventual diagnostic and therapeutic alternatives and about the foreseen consequences of the realized choices. The physician should take into account the knowledge of the patient, in order for the patient to understand the proposed diagnostic-therapeutic alternatives.
